Trump countersues E Jean Carroll for defamation following jury verdict in sexual abuse case

PTC News Desk: Former US President Donald Trump has filed a defamation lawsuit against E Jean Carroll, accusing her of falsely accusing him of rape. This countersuit comes after a civil trial jury made an unusual finding in May, stating that Trump had sexually abused and defamed Carroll, a former advice columnist for Elle magazine, but did not rape her.

In the lawsuit filed at the Manhattan federal court, Trump is seeking a retraction from Carroll as well as unspecified compensatory and punitive damages.


Roberta Kaplan, Carroll's lawyer, responded to Trump's filing, stating that it was merely an attempt to avoid being held accountable for the jury's verdict. Kaplan asserted that Trump's argument, claiming exoneration based on the jury's finding of sexual abuse, goes against logic and facts.

Trump's legal team has yet to comment on the matter.

With Trump's recent filing, it appears that the legal battle between him and Carroll will continue, with both sides exchanging accusations and denials through the media.

Carroll, in May, amended one of her lawsuits against Trump, seeking an additional $10 million in damages. This was prompted by Trump's denial during a CNN appearance the day after the jury verdict was announced.
